The same company makes several different kinds of machines. Some states require paper trail, for example, and others do not. The company will make the machine either way.

Several years ago about 40 people were on the Secretary of State's "HAVA Committee". The primary purpose of the committee was to help make recommendations for electronic voting machines- to be paid for by federal $$$ after Congress the Help America Vote Act. I was there representing the Mountain Party. On that committee were also representatives of the Democratic and Republican parties, of the League of Women Voters, of WV Citizen Action Group, and of the County Clerks Association, among others.

One of the meetings was a day long demonstration of various kinds of electronic voting machines. The only committee group that objected to paper trails was the County Clerks Association. Their only stated rationale was that "they are not necessary". The voting machine company reps., who work closely with County Commissions and Clerks in an effort to sell their machines, tried to talk down the idea of a paper trail. I suspect this was because (1) they knew that Clerks didn't want them, and (2) with the paper trail there is some implication that maybe the electronic vote recording part of the machines were less than dependable, among maybe other reasons.

But the recommendations for an auditable paper trail won out, and so whatever model of machine counties in West Virginia use, it must have an auditable paper trail. Not so in all states.

"FYI, in most states, by state law, organizations conducting voter registration drives are required to turn in all the forms they collect. So ACORN cannot engage in discrimination by tossing out *any* forms, period.

In fact, ACORN generally categorizes the forms they receive as “good”, “incomplete”, and “questionable”, and turns them in in separate bundles with cover sheets indicating that. Most of the ones they are being accused of fraud on are ones they themselves categorized as “questionable”.


This deal in Indiana was exacerbated by grandstanding republican election officials implying that they uncovered some kind of fraudulent plot when Acorn themselves had already sorted them and marked them.

They were merely complying with state law by turning them in.
